nullBritish Airways new-media chief Julia Groves is leaving to head the
launch of business-to-consumer companies at newly-launched eVentures.

London toy store Hamleys is revamping its e-commerce operation to
sell exclusive UK-themed products aimed at US shoppers.

NetBenefit has bought NetNames for #20m in cash and shares. NetNames,
which provides domain name services for clients including BMW, Amazon and
Netscape, will see its brand retained for high-end domain name
services.

Jungle.com has become the first company to be suspended from the
Consumer Association s Which? web trader scheme after the CA received 90
complaints between September and November. Complaints were mainly about
non delivery or debiting customers cards without goods being dispatched.

Fashion e-tailer Zoom (www.zoom.co.uk) has launched a new fax,
voicemail and email messaging service called Zoomlink. Members call an
allocated number and enter their PIN to listen to voice messages, fax
messages and have their email read to them.

VNU Business Publishing Europe has re-grouped its expanding net
operations into a new division. VNU Business On-line Europe will
concentrate on IT news, products and career information.

The Internet Advertising Bureau is launching a task force to examine
new ways of measuring web site performance. It will focus on user
definitions and data.

Argos web site was temporarily taken down last Wednesday due to an
unexpected number of orders. In a statement, Argos said that e-shopping
will be a significant factor in the company s plans and efforts are being
made to ensure that expectations are met.
